‘Best years ahead of him’: Bullemor inks long-term contract extension with Sea Eagles


The Manly Sea Eagles have rewarded versatile forward Ethan Bullemor with a four-year contract extension that will keep him at the club until at least 2029.

Bullemor has scored 12 tries in 101 games for the Broncos and Sea Eagles since his debut in 2020.

“Manly Warringah Sea Eagles are delighted to confirm a four-year contract extension for Ethan Bullemor,” the club said in a statement.

The new deal will see the 25-year-old forward remain at Manly until at least the end of the 2029 season.

Now in his fourth season at the club, Bullemor recently made his 100th NRL appearance in Manly’s Round 20 victory over the Storm in Melbourne.

“I’m thrilled to extend my stay here at Manly, I love the club and the people who make it,” Bullemor said.

“I am excited about what we can achieve for the rest of this season, and then into the future.”

Sea Eagles coach Anthony Seibold, who gave Bullemor his NRL debut several years ago at Brisbane, has been impressed by Ethan’s rapid development.

“It’s great for the club that ‘Bull’ has extended his stay at Manly because I know his best years are ahead of him,” Seibold said.

“I’ve been really impressed with his growth as a player and how well he has developed his game as a middle forward.”

The Sea Eagles play the Roosters for the Gotcha4Life Cup in Round 22 at 4 Pines Park on Saturday 2 August (7.35pm).
